Monday 11 March 2013

New Easy2Boot BETA



Once made (install onto fresh USB FLASH drive (Vista+ OS installs will not work if on an HDD) and then install grub4dos using latest RMPrepUSB), the following Optional files can be added:
Add XP Pro and Home SP2 and SP3 install ISOs to \_ISO\Windows\XP folder to install XP
Add Vista 32 and 64 ISOs to \_ISO\Windows\Vista folder to install Vista
Add Win7 32&64 generic&Enterprise ISOs to \_ISO\Windows\Win7 folder
Add SVR2K8R2 ISOs to \_ISO\Windows\SVR2K8R2 folder
Add Win8 32&64 generic&Enterprise ISOs to \_ISO\Windows\Win8 folder - for generic ISO, you will be asked if you want Consumer or Pro and a dummy Product key will be provided or you can enter your own key.
Add SVR2012 ISOs to \_ISO\Windows\SVR2012 folder - not yet tested as I don't have a full copy!

In addition, if you have clonezilla, acronis rescue, Kasperksy, UBCD etc. ISO files - just copy these and any other LiveCD ISOs you fancy into the \_ISO\AUTOISO folder.

You can still add .mnu files in the same way as before.
Make sure to run WinContig to make the ISOs contiguous (use RMPrepUSB - Ctrl+F2).

Feedback welcome - I have not yet tested the following ISOs:
XP SP2
Win7 64
Win7 ent
Win8 64
Win8 ent
SVR2K8R2
SVR2012

I have tested
XP SP3
Vista 32 SP1
Win7 32 SP1
Win 8 32 (Consumer+Pro)
clonezilla, acronis rescue, Kasperksy, UBCD ISOs (just copy into AUTOISO folder)
memtest86+, freedos fdd image

Follow it's development on the reboot.pro forum here.

Saturday 9 March 2013

YouTube RMPrepUSB and grub4dos videos now available

Despite suffering from a cold, I managed to get the following videos up onto YouTube:



Part 1            - Basic USB formatting with RMPrepUSB
Part 2a and b - Advanced features of RMPrepUSB
Part 3a and b - Making a multiboot grub4dos drive using RMPrepUSB

Each one is about 15 minutes long (max allowed!).

Part 1

Part 2a

Part 2b

Part 3a grub4dos

Part 3b grub4dos  cont.


Macrium Reflect Free Edition provides easy way to generate WinPE

Tutorial 107 describes how to create a WinPE bootable ISO without needing to type anything on the command line or do anything more complicated than click a few buttons.
It uses Macrium Reflect Free Edition to build a nice Windows PE (v3 SP1) bootable ISO which you can then add to your multiboot grub4dos USB drive.
It will also make backups or restore your hard disk and fix boot problems too!


Thursday 7 March 2013

RMPrepUSB v2.1.659 now available

This version has a few tweaks and the latest version of grub4dos (grldr).
One new feature - make a grub4dos bootable ISO from a grub4dos bootable drive. This allows you to build and test your grub4dos multiboot system using a USB flash drive (for instance) and then when you are happy with it, you can convert it to an ISO file, test it using RMPrepUSB Boot from ISO, and if all is OK, burn the ISO to a CD or DVD (using external burn s\w).
Also, 'How to use RMPrepUSB' videos are now on YouTube.
http://www.rmprepusb.com/tutorials/video-tutorials - part 1, 2a and 2b.
Part 3 will be about grub4dos (when I get the time!).
If there is anything you would like me to cover in it, let me know!


Wednesday 27 February 2013

Sample grub4dos menus

I have made available a few sample grub4dos menus here. This allows you to test out different resolution bitmaps on diffferent systems.
Some include example uses of the menusetting utility which changes the size and position of the menu on the screen. One also loads the UniFont font file for you to view it's affect.
Note that some of the files are in UTF-8 format as they contain unicode characters (e.g. Chinese).



Saturday 16 February 2013

Boot pclinuxos from an iso with persistence

pclinuxos can be booted from an ISO file, however it will not boot if the ISO file is on an NTFS USB drive (it cannot find the cdlive.sqfs file). In addition, persistence will not work unless an ext2/3 partition is available.
However, by using the grub4dos partnew command and mapping the iso to one partition on the USB drive, and an ext2 file to another partition on the USB drive, we can boot pclinuxos from an ISO with persistence.
To see how to do this have a look at Tutorial 104.


Saturday 9 February 2013

A Puppy is not just for Xmas!

I have added a .mnu file for the Easy2Boot project for Puppy Linux Precise 5.4.3 with persistence.
Just add the ISO (named precise-5.4.3.iso) to your Easy2Boot's \_ISO\Linux folder and then add the .mnu file.
When you first boot Puppy and then Exit, it will prompt you to save settings to a file at the root of the USB drive. It will also prompt you to copy the .sfs file from 'CD' to the USB drive - you should answer No to this as there is no speed advantage. When you next boot Puppy, your new settings will also be loaded.

Easy2Boot Tutorial #72.See here for a forum discussion. 

v2.1.657 - File Info function updated to display boot sector info

If you use Drive Info in RMPrepUSB to read sectors from a disk, if it is recognised as an MBR or PBR, the internal values will be parsed and displayed for you in Notepad. However, the File Info function in RMPartUSB only displayed MBR values if it detected a valid MBR but did not display PBR values. v2.1.657 fixes this. Now you can use File Info to display the hex data in a bootsect.dat PBR file, for instance, and it will parse the BPB for you - e.g.


COMMAND LINE: FILE="F:\bootsect.dat" FILEINFO FILESTART=0 SURE 

FAT32
000B Bytes Per Sector = 512 (0200h)
000D Sectors Per Cluster = 8 (08h)
000E Reserved Sectors before first FAT = 32 (0020h)
0010 Number of FATs = 2 (02h)
0011 Root Entries = 0 (0000h)
0013 Total Log Sectors (small) = 0 (0000h)
0015 Media Descriptor = 248 (F8h) HDD
0016 Sectors per FAT table = 0 (0000h)
0018 Sectors per Track = 63 (003Fh)
001A Number of Heads per Cylinder = 255 (00FFh)
001C Hidden Sectors preceding Partition = 63 (0000003Fh)
0020 Total Log. Sectors (big) = 16203713 (00F73FC1h)
0024 Log. Sectors per FAT = 15794 (00003DB2h)
0028 Mirroring Flags = 0 (0000h)
002A Version No. = 0 (0000h)
002C Cluster No. of Root Dir Start = 2 (00000002h)
0030 Log. Sector No. of FS Info Sector = 1 (0001h)
0032 First logical sector number of a copy of the three FAT32 boot sectors, typically 6 = 6 (0006h)
0040 Physical Drive Number = 128 (80h) First Fixed Disk
0042 Extended Boot Signature = 41 (29h)
0047 Volume Label = NO NAME    
0052 FileSystem Type = FAT32   

First FAT begins at LBA 95
Second FAT begins at LBA 15889
Root Directory begins at LBA 31683
First file data (cluster 0) begins at LBA 31691

Thursday 7 February 2013

WinToFlash or WinToSlug?

A recent post on reboot.pro complained that a USB flash drive that was prepared for XP installs using WinToFlash, worked well on one system, but would not boot on another and gave an 'NTLDR is missing' error.
I decided to try WinToFlash with an XP install ISO for myself. The first thing I found was that when using the default settings, when I used a USB flash drive created by WinToFlash, the first text mode XP install copy files phase took over 70 minutes!
It turns out this is due to FAT32 being used by WinToFlash for the USB drive format. If this is changed to FAT16LBA, then the 2GB volume created on my 8GB USB drive, when booted will install the same XP files in just 7 minutes.
I also found that if I reformatted the same USB drive as 8GB NTFS and used grub4dos to launch setup, the same install phase takes just over 4 minutes.
To learn how to make the NTFS WinToFlash drive, read Tutorial 102.
By using NTFS, it also removes the 'NTDLR not found' issue - although I have also given details of how this can be avoided even if you 'stick' (pardon the pun!) to FAT.